For trim clips I went to a specialty trim store here, Nebraska/Iowa trim shop. I found the best nylon clips I have ever used. They have trimable edges that are scored and you cut them to fit your trim piece and they lock tight and don't scratch your finish as you are putting on the trim. No more metal ones to scratch, rust, and mess with your car in general. Check around, they are out there at specialty trim shops. You will love'em.
